PopChef is a start-up foodtech business in the lunchtime food delivery market in Paris. The case centres on the period from launch in 2015 to 2017. PopChef is the first to enter the market with a new business model in France. As other well-funded domestic and international entrants arrive, the market becomes highly competitive market.

The case charts the past decade of online grocery retailing at Tesco.com and the development and launch of the non-food operation “Tesco Direct”. Tesco implemented a unique fulfillment model by using its vast network of bricks-and-mortar supermarkets across the UK to pick the items ordered by online customers.

The case analyses the failed introduction of genetically modified organisms (GMO) in Europe by Monsanto. Showing how a favourable context (the legacy of mad-cow disease) made it relatively easy for consumer groups and environmentalists to wage successful anti-GMO campaigns in Europe, the case examines how Monsanto attempted to deal with its image problem and how the company's efforts backfired.

The (A) case describes the situation of Cadbury Schweppes and its sugar confectionary business, in a state of “satisfactory underperformance” in which past strategies and practices make it hard for new management to initiate change in this widely respected company.
